SB 17-256 Colorado Senate · 2017 Regular Session

Hospital Reimbursement Rates

Summary
Joint Budget Committee. For the 2017-18 state fiscal year, if the amount of revenue collected from the hospital provider fee is insufficient to fully fund all of the statutory purposes for the fee, the bill requires any reduction to be taken from hospital reimbursements. The bill reduces the cash funds appropriation from the hospital provider fee in the 2017 annual general appropriation act by $264,100,000. (Note: This summary applies to the reengrossed version of this bill as introduced in the second house.)
